WebInfrared LED Proximity Sensors. The simplest approach to measuring distance using infrared light is to measure the amount of emitted IR light that bounces off a target and reflects back to the sensor. The ranges are relatively small — between 0 and 20cm — and the language used is ‘proximity’ rather than ‘distance’.
